Subject: DR drill — Spoolhawk printer service

Drill is Thursday. We fail over Spoolhawk to the Kessel site, verify queue replay, then fail back. Release manager: hold all spooler deploys that day. Restoring the standby's credential store during failback requires the recovery passphrase, which is:

unlock words, kajef-kadug: sorys-pelax-lamael-tamvan-briiel-novdor-fenwyn-tamdor-oliion-keleth-julok-belion-ralok

MEMO — Veltrane Systems, Receiving, Dorsey Point site

Six Quillax M4 demo units are being returned from the Harwick trade floor. All were powered down and factory-reset by the field team; do not re-image before intake inspection. Log serial plates against the loan sheet and flag any missing styli. Cartons are marked DEMO RETURN in orange. Expected arrival Thursday morning via courier. Storage bay 3 is reserved. The confidential hand-over instruction for the courier follows below.

courier memo of kagug-yajof: the belys wenok courier leaves the praix ledger at gate 8902 under passcode 669584

Q: Why do my Fernbolt builds randomly fail signature checks?

A: Clock skew. The build agents in the Ostermill pool drift because their NTP sync is flaky, and the signing step rejects timestamps more than 30 seconds off. Quick fix: re-queue the job and it usually lands on a healthy agent. Long-term, we're moving to the Chronarch sync service. To force a manual resync on an agent, the admin shell prompts for the recovery passphrase below.

unlock words, tawif-tahop: oliys-ulawyn-tamdor-lamys-casox-jormir-fraius-kasath-ulador-ulamir-holir-sorys-holeth